A Nation in the Hands of an Angry God
May 30, 2020
May 30, 2020
1hr 4 min
At a time when the judgment of God is evident upon our nation as hatred and violence erupt around us, Chris and Rich discuss how even well-intended online discussions can fan the flames of an angry people. Not only what topics we choose to engage but how we address these issues can inadvertently add fuel to the fire. As Christians, even in matters of important doctrinal issues, we must treat others as creations in the image and likeness of God, showing grace and mercy as God has been merciful to us. In this episode, they also ask the listeners to take time to pray that God would pour out His mercy on our nation.

Cultural Manliness vs. Biblical Manhood
May 16, 2020
May 16, 2020
1hr 14 min
This week, Chris and Rich ask the question "What defines manliness?" Cultural definitions are as plentiful as there are grains of sand on the beach. But, true manliness is found in the character and teachings of Jesus Christ.

Harvard Magazine Calls Homeschooling Dangerous
Apr 25, 2020
Apr 25, 2020
1hr 47 min
This week, Chris and Rich discuss a recent Harvard Magazine article that claims homeschooling is dangerous and calls for a presumptive ban. Are the claims of the article valid? How should Christians respond to such allegations?

Is COVID-19 a Cover for Christian Persecution?
Mar 30, 2020
Mar 30, 2020
1hr 29 min
Today, Rodney Howard-Browne, a false teacher in Tampa Bay, Florida was arrested after refusing to follow the county's mandate to cease gatherings of more than 10 people under CDC guidelines. Despite the directive, Howard-Browne continued his church's weekly gatherings, resulting in his arrest. Is persecution of the Christian church occurring under the guise of health and safety? Should Christians be concerned about Howard-Browne's arrest? Chris and Rich discuss.
